### Vigilume proctoring queue: manual drain procedure

Plugin authors integrating with the Vigilume exam-proctoring queue should be aware that stalled review items older than ninety minutes must be drained manually rather than requeued, since requeueing resets the integrity timer and can invalidate a candidate's session. Use the drain endpoint with the batch flag set, and always confirm the reviewer pool is paused first to avoid double assignment. Authentication against the internal Vigilume dispatch service requires the key that follows.

API key for kahop-bagef: zpat2_yb

- [ ] **Step 7: Breaker override escrow.** After sealing the signing keys for the Tallgrove upstream API circuit breaker, confirm the support team can force the breaker open during a full outage. The override bundle lives in the sealed escrow drawer and is useless without its unlock phrase. Two ceremony witnesses must initial this step before proceeding. The escrow bundle is decrypted with the recovery passphrase that follows.

vault phrase of kahip-kahop = holath-quenmir

## Vendored Fonts — Storefront Assets

Third-party fonts for the Pellwick storefront are vendored into the assets store, not fetched at runtime. Support should never link external font files. Licensing metadata lives in the same table as the font blobs. To check which versions shipped with a release, query the assets database directly with the connection string below.

primary connection of tajeg-tajop = postgresql://julax_svc:DI@db-e7f3.kelvidyn.corp:5432/rusdor

Finance Review Summary — Discount Policy for Large Deals. The board is asked to note that Varnelle Systems' current discount framework permits up to 18% on contracts exceeding threshold volumes, but three recent Kestrane deals breached this without escalation. We recommend tightening approval gates and quarterly audits. Context for this recommendation follows below.

management briefing: The southern region missed its Oliox quota by 51.7 percent last quarter. Juldorek Freight plans to raise the Silath list price by 49.7 percent in January. The board signed off on a budget of $388.0 million for Project Casok. The renewal with Fradorix Foods closes at $53.0 million a year, 49.8 percent below the last contract.